数据库 · 20 10 月, 2024

Oracle數據庫日常維護手冊

Oracle數據庫日常維護手冊

Oracle數據庫作為一個強大的關聯數據庫管理系統,廣泛應用於各種企業環境中。為了確保數據庫的穩定性和性能,日常維護是必不可少的。本文將介紹Oracle數據庫的日常維護步驟和最佳實踐,幫助管理員有效地管理數據庫。

1. 定期備份

數據備份是數據庫維護中最重要的一環。定期備份可以防止數據丟失,並在系統故障時快速恢復。Oracle提供了多種備份選項,包括:

  • 冷備份:在數據庫關閉的情況下進行備份,確保數據的一致性。
  • 熱備份:在數據庫運行時進行備份,適合需要高可用性的環境。
  • 增量備份:僅備份自上次備份以來變更的數據,節省存儲空間。

使用RMAN(Recovery Manager)工具可以簡化備份過程,並提供恢復的靈活性。

2. 性能監控

監控數據庫性能是確保其高效運行的關鍵。管理員應定期檢查以下指標:

  • CPU使用率:高CPU使用率可能表明查詢效率低下或資源不足。
  • 內存使用情況:確保數據庫有足夠的內存來處理請求。
  • 磁碟I/O:監控磁碟讀寫速度,避免瓶頸影響性能。

可以使用Oracle的自動工作負載庫(AWR)報告來獲取詳細的性能數據。

3. 數據庫清理

隨著時間的推移,數據庫中可能會積累大量不必要的數據。定期清理可以釋放空間並提高性能。清理的步驟包括:

  • 刪除過期的數據:定期檢查並刪除不再需要的數據。
  • 重建索引:隨著數據的變更,索引可能會變得不再高效,定期重建索引可以提高查詢性能。
  • 更新統計信息:確保數據庫擁有最新的統計信息,以便優化查詢計劃。

4. 安全性檢查

數據庫的安全性是維護過程中不可忽視的一部分。管理員應定期檢查以下方面:

  • 用戶權限:定期審核用戶權限,確保只有授權用戶可以訪問敏感數據。
  • 數據加密:對敏感數據進行加密,以防止未經授權的訪問。
  • 日誌檔案檢查:定期檢查數據庫日誌檔案,及時發現異常行為。

5. 更新和升級

保持Oracle數據庫的最新版本是確保其安全性和性能的關鍵。管理員應定期檢查Oracle的更新和補丁,並根據需要進行升級。升級前,建議在測試環境中進行充分測試,以避免在生產環境中出現問題。

總結

Oracle數據庫的日常維護是確保其穩定性和性能的關鍵。通過定期備份、性能監控、數據清理、安全性檢查以及更新升級,管理員可以有效地管理數據庫,減少故障風險。對於需要高效能和穩定性的企業,選擇合適的VPS解決方案也是至關重要的。了解更多關於香港VPS伺服器的資訊,請訪問我們的網站。